Job Description Job Description JOB DESCRIPTION Watershed
Security, is a Veteran Owned Small Business with over 20 years’
Cybersecurity and Government Contracting experiencing. Watershed is
looking for a Journeyman Information Systems Security Engineer
(ISSE) to support the Naval Surface Warfare Center (NSWC) in
Philadelphia, PA. The successful candidates will have experience
coordinating and enacting required security changes, with in
various levels of an organization, ensuring compliance with
published policies; conducting cybersecurity vulnerability and
threat analysis; and support cyber incident-response by isolating
potentially effected assets, initial investigation and data
collection, through status updates/reporting. REQUIRED
QUALIFICATIONS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, IT, or
equivalent technical degree. Must have at least one of the
following active certifications: CCNA-Security, CySA, GICSP, GSEC,
Security CE, CND, SSCP Years of Experience: 3 years practical
experience in a cybersecurity or A&A related field. Collaborate
with various levels of the organization to implement required
security changes and ensure compliance with established security
policies and standards. Conduct comprehensive cybersecurity
vulnerability and threat assessments to identify and mitigate risks
to information systems. Lead cyber-incident-response efforts,
including isolating affected systems, conducting initial
investigations, collecting relevant data, and providing status
updates and reports to leadership. Provide guidance on best
practices and recommend improvements to the organization's security
posture. Perform risk assessments and develop mitigation strategies
to protect sensitive data from internal and external threats.
Support continuous monitoring of information systems and provide
regular status reports on security compliance. Maintain up-to-date
knowledge of emerging cybersecurity threats and industry best
practices. Clearance Level: SECRET; US Citizen. Ability to possibly
provide onsite support in Norfolk, VA. Some/all remote work may be
an option, however the norm will be onsite support. This will be
dependent upon customer needs and classification level of work
being performed. Some travel may be required. Experience with the
Navy RMF Process Guide (RPG), and Navy A&A tools such as ACAS,
eMASS and eMASSter. Proficient with Microsoft Office Suite (Word,
Excel, Teams, Project). Self Starter; detail oriented; able to
brief senior level staff. DESIRED QUALIFICATIONS Experience
supporting 5 or more Navy Packages (achieving and/or maintaining
ATO) Experience with the NAVSEA RMF Business Rules Contingent upon
